A reminder this Friday/Saturday/Sunday that SURF FX, Goodtime and Sunshine Coast Sailboards have organised demos for Starboard and Severne.

It has been a few years since our last demos in QLD and so much has changed from Severne and Starboard. These demos are really good opportunity to see what has changed and what is coming from two of the most progressive brands in windsurfing.

The dates and locations for the demos are as follows

Surf FX - Gold Coast, QLD 3 December 2010 - The "Train" Nth Street on the Broadwater - From 1pm

Goodtime - Redcliffe, QLD 4 December 2010 - Queens Beach, Redcliffe - From 10am - 5pm

Sunshine Coast Sailboards - Caloundra, QLD 5 December 2010 - Golden Beach Caloundra - From 12pm - 5pm
